Integrating Browser-Based Applications

Successfully incorporating web experiences into your website requires careful consideration. While the technology itself offers impressive versatility, overlooking best procedures can lead to rendering issues or a unprofessional viewer encounter. A common approach involves using the <iframe> element, which provides a isolated space for the game to reside. However, alternative solutions, such as utilizing JavaScript to dynamically load the game into the page, can offer greater command over the presentation. Always optimize your interactive content's assets, including images and sound, to minimize file sizes and ensure fast first rendering times. Furthermore, prioritizing adaptive design is critical for a satisfying experience across a variety of platforms.

Embedding HTML5 Game Production

Successfully presenting your HTML5 application within a wider website or platform involves more than just slapping in some code. While basic embedding is feasible, truly mastering the process requires understanding a range of techniques and leveraging various frameworks. A straightforward solution might involve directly including the HTML file within an iframe, though this can sometimes constrain responsiveness and styling options. More sophisticated developers often opt for frameworks like Phaser, PixiJS, or Babylon.js. These tools handle difficulties such as asset organization, rendering optimization, and cross-browser functionality. Moreover, consider strategies for responsive design – ensuring your application looks and functions flawlessly across different screen dimensions. Ultimately, the best option depends on the project's extent and your desired level of command.
